  18. I think the girls situation is worse than the boys because they are more competitive due to the fact they have more outlets to play and get better. The girls in Metro for the most part start playing ball at a older age and have to play catch up thru their high school years .They don't have places they can go and play pickup games against other girls on a regular basis. Most Metro girls only play ball during the school season.There is a lack of developing girls at the younger ages.There are a few leagues around town that have all girl leagues for the younger ages,but most parents don't know about them or would rather their daughters become cheerleaders until the child grows to six feet tall then they try and shove the ball down their throat.Memphis does a good job at the rec and AAU basketball.A lot of our beloved high school coaches should carry some of the blame. In the county schools the coaches work together with the rec leagues and the middle schools and the AAU programs to develope a farm system so they know they have a steady stream of players. We have no such communication here.Instead we have coaches saying they don't like AAU in spite of the fact most of their better players benefit from playing in the off season.
